Ikorodu City returns to winning ways with narrow NPFL victory

Ikorodu City beats Kwara United 1-0 in NPFL match, lifting them to third place, while Rivers United and Bendel Insurance also record wins


Ikorodu City returned to winning ways in the Nigeria Premier Football League (NPFL) on Sunday, defeating Kwara United 1-0 at the Mobolaji Johnson Arena, Lagos.

The decisive goal came inside five minutes when Samuel Ezekiel met a precise cross from Jaguar Uche to head the hosts into an early lead.

Kwara United fought to level the score, with Akeem Akanni, Johnmark Aule, and Babatunde Bright creating chances.

Akanni’s powerful strike forced a fine save from Ikorodu goalkeeper Michael Atata, and Aule’s follow-up narrowly missed.

Second-half tactical substitutions, including Eze Ogbodo, Mahe Alege, and Mustapha Salisu, added energy, but Kwara could not breach Ikorodu’s defence.

The win moves Ikorodu City to 35 points from 21 matches, securing third place on the NPFL table.

Kwara United remain 16th with 24 points and will host Rivers United in their next fixture.

Elsewhere on matchday 21, Rivers United edged past 10-man Remo Stars 1-0 at home, with Okon Aniekeme scoring the late winner.

The Sky Blues Stars had been reduced to ten men after Chilekwu Chigozie was sent off in the 50th minute.

Rivers now top the NPFL standings on 41 points, followed by Abia Warriors on 37 after a 1-0 win over Kano Pillars.

Other results saw Bendel Insurance defeat El-Kanemi Warriors 3-2, Bayelsa United overcome Shooting Stars 2-0, and Plateau United narrowly beat Wikki Tourists 1-0 through Temitope Vincent. Nasarawa United defeated Niger Tornadoes 2-1, while Enyimba drew 0-0 with Barau in coach Deji Ayeni’s first game.

At the lower end, Khalifat remain 20th with 18 points, and Remo Stars slipped to 15th after their latest defeat.
